As April-June for the most part represents Q1, we doubt real estate sector +81-3-6776-4665

April-June results will bring major surprises. Although the outlook for higher masashi.miki@citi.com

interest rates remains a concern, sector share prices have already

undergone significant adjustments in recent months. We expect Q1 results

to confirm the favorable trend in real estate fundamentals, particularly the

robust demand in the office leasing market. We will be looking for indicators

of possible guidance hikes and increased shareholder returns in Q2. The

stocks to watch ahead of the earnings announcements include Mitsubishi

Estate, Tokyo Tatemono, Mitsui Fudosan, and Sumitomo Realty &

Development.

Names to watch — For Mitsubishi Estate, expectations are high for its overseas

business, which offers greater stability than the overseas operations of competitors.

The momentum from rising top-tier rents is also a positive factor. For Tokyo

Tatemono, the focus will be on its profit progress catch-up and discussions around

the medium-term plan. Mitsui Fudosan's Q1 performance appears to be weak, but it

has a wealth of catalysts from Q2 onwards. Sumitomo Realty & Development looks

undervalued after its price decline in recent months.

Medium- to long-term preference order — Mitsui Fudosan > Mitsubishi Estate >

Sumitomo Realty > Nomura Real Estate HD > Tokyu Fudosan HD > Tokyo Tatemono

> Hulic
